Address

ecash:qru70w7fkc4drvd6t03h2xs7jujna2r0vvyqxg2ffuCopy

Total Received

23005786.27 XEC

Total Sent

23005786.27 XEC

№ Transactions

3

Final Balance

0 XEC

Transactions
Filter